Jais urges muslims to participate in prayers next week

SHAH ALAM, March 29 — The Selangor Islamic Religious Department (JAIS) is urging Muslims in the state to take part in the ‘People of Selangor Prayer Programme’ (Rakyat Selangor Berdoa) on Monday and Thursday to seek god’s protection from Covid-19.

JAIS director Mohd Shahzihan Ahmad said the prayer and recitation (zikir) programme would be implemented in their respective homes #stayathome at 8.50 pm after the Isyak prayer.

“Imams at mosques and surau will perform the prayers and recitations using loudspeakers in the absence of the congregations at the mosques and surau,” he said in a statement here yesterday.

He said Muslims who wanted to follow the programme could watch it live on the Facebooks of the Sultan Salahuddin Abdul Aziz Shah Mosque and Tengku Ampuan Jemaah Mosque, Bukit Jelutong.

“JAIS urges Muslims in Selangor to together perform the prayers and recitations for mental and physical strength and abundant patience especially the frontline personnel and national leaders who have been working hard to look after the security and health of the people in the country from Covid-19,” he said.

He said JAIS also urged Muslims to comply with the directives of the National Security Council and to make use of the movement control order (MCO) to conduct prayers with their families.
